What were the two opposing views in the United States regarding the French Revolution?

Respuesta :

gabymiaaguilar97 gabymiaaguilar97
  • 03-03-2021

Answer: The United States remained neutral, as both Federalists and Democratic-Republicans saw that war would lead to economic disaster and the possibility of invasion. This policy was made difficult by heavy-handed British and French actions.
